We'll go through a bunch of the Kansas City Chiefs and Indianapolis Colts connections this week but here's a good Tennessee Volunteers connection:
Eric Berry vs. Peyton Manning.
Both are from UT, though 12 years apart, so the topic was brought up when Berry made an appearance on 680 The Fan in Atlanta (H/T jmcgoblue) this week. Here's what Berry said:
"I brought my DVDs with me, the coach cutups of their plays. I was watching it on the plane. I'm going to watch some more today. I'm trying to get ready for him in any type of way. We have a big challenge in Peyton, man. Growing up, watching him, seeing how he can pick apart a defense...we just know we have a big challenge and we've gotta make sure we're ready."
Berry will have his hands full, that's for sure. Manning understands the weaknesses in a defense so, if Berry not on top of his game, he'll pay for it.
